Keosauqua Iowa March 22/58 Mr Weaver, Really I must acknowledge that sounds quite formal, but I do not know as I can better it any, yet it makes me feel just like we had never met more than once or twice. But to convince you I do not feel just as that "Mr Weaver" sounds I hasten to answer your letter so you can get it this evening. Although I am afraid it will not be as acceptable as I would like it to be, and for this reason. Since this morning a week ago I have had some pretty serious thoughts for me to have.
